Technical Field
The invention relates to the technical field of carriers, in particular to a full-automatic electric carrier.
Background
Industrial material handling vehicles are commonly found in warehouses, factories, shipping docks, and often in those locations where pallets, large packages, or cargo loads need to be transported from one location to another, material handling vehicles, commonly known as pallet trucks, typically include a load bearing fork to lift a package or pallet for transport, an electric motor to propel the vehicle in operation, a steering control mechanism, and a brake, with various electrical components mounted within the vehicle frame of the vehicle to control the operation and shutdown of each of the mechanisms.

Referring to fig. 1-7, a full-automatic electric truck comprises an electric truck body 1, a moving direction control rod 13 is arranged on one side of the top of the electric truck body 1, a lifting plate 14 is movably sleeved in an inner cavity of the moving direction control rod 13, a connecting column 15 is fixedly installed on the top of the lifting plate 14, a handle 16 is fixedly installed on the top of the connecting column 15, a sleeve 27 is movably sleeved on the outer side of the connecting column 15, a connecting plate 17 is fixedly installed on one side of the sleeve 27, the bottom of the connecting plate 17 is fixedly installed on the top of a pedal 11, the pedal 11 is connected with the sleeve 27 through the connecting plate 17, so that the handle 16 can be driven to move upwards when the pedal 11 moves, the handle 16 is convenient for a worker to operate, the section of the inner cavity of the moving direction control rod 13 is square, the lifting plate 14 is cuboid in whole, and the section of the, the lifting plate 14 is integrally rectangular, so that the lifting plate 14 can move in the inner cavity of the moving direction control rod 13, and the lifting plate 14 can drive the moving direction control rod 13 to rotate when rotating, one side of the electric carrier body 1 is provided with the fork 2, the center of the bottom of the fork 2 is fixedly provided with the second motor 18, the output shaft of the second motor 18 is fixedly sleeved with the lead screw 19, the outer side of the lead screw 19 is movably sleeved with the moving frame 20, the top of the moving frame 20 is contacted with the bottom of the fork 2, one side of the inner side of the moving frame 20 is fixedly provided with the third motor 21, the output shaft of the third motor 21 is fixedly sleeved with the protection plate 22, the lead screw 19 is driven to rotate by the second motor 18, the lead screw 19 is meshed and connected with the moving frame 20, so that the moving frame 20 is driven to move along the bottom of the fork 2, the protection plate 22 is moved out from the bottom of, the third motor 21 is used as a drive to drive the protection plate 22 to rotate, so that the protection plate 22 is parallel to the side face of the goods, the side face of the goods is protected conveniently, and the goods are prevented from falling off, the front side and the rear side of the second motor 18 are provided with the screw rods 19 which are symmetrically distributed, the inner cavity of the moving frame 20 is provided with the screw threads which are meshed with the screw rods 19, the two moving frames 20 can be driven to move in opposite directions simultaneously when the screw rods 19 rotate, one side of the bottom of the fork 2 is provided with the moving groove 23, the top of the inner cavity of the moving groove 23 is fixedly provided with the spring 24, the bottom of the spring 24 is fixedly provided with the moving column 25, the bottom of the moving column 25 is fixedly provided with the universal wheel 26, the bottom of the fork 2 is provided with the spring 24, the moving column 25 and the universal wheel 26, when the pallet fork 2 is convenient to jack up and move the goods, the universal wheel 26 can be contacted with the ground, the pallet fork 2 is supported, the stability of the pallet fork 2 in moving is improved, the case 3 is fixedly arranged on the other side of the electric carrier body 1, the moving port 4 is arranged on one side of the case 3, the chain wheel 5 is movably sleeved on the upper part and the lower part of the inner cavity of the case 3 through a shaft, the first motor 6 is fixedly arranged on one side of the inner cavity of the case 3, the output shaft of the first motor 6 is fixedly sleeved on one side of one of the chain wheels 5, the chain 7 is meshed on the outer side of the chain wheel 5, the auxiliary block 8 is movably sleeved on one side of the chain 7 through a shaft, the length of the auxiliary block 8 is three centimeters less than half of the length of the inner cavity of the moving frame 9, the upper side and the lower side of the inner cavity of the moving frame 9 are contacted with the upper side and the lower side of the, make the auxiliary block 8 can move in the inner chamber that removes frame 9 along with the removal of chain 7, the outside activity of auxiliary block 8 has cup jointed removes frame 9, one side fixed mounting who removes frame 9 has movable plate 10, the outside activity of movable plate 10 cup joints in the inner chamber that removes mouth 4, one side fixed mounting of movable plate 10 has footboard 11, the equal fixed mounting in front and back side at footboard 11 top has handrail frame 12, handrail frame 12's whole is the T word shape, all be equipped with handrail frame 12 through the front and back side at footboard 11 top, be convenient for assistant work personnel stand on footboard 11.
The working principle is as follows: when the electric pallet truck is used, a worker stands on the top of the pedal 11 to control the electric pallet truck body 1 to move the pallet fork 2 to the position below the bottom of a cargo, the cargo is jacked upwards, the universal wheels 26 are still contacted with the ground by the aid of the springs 24, the two screw rods 19 are driven to rotate simultaneously by operation of the second motor 18, the two screw rods 19 are symmetrically distributed on the front side and the rear side of the second motor 18, the moving frames 20 are meshed with the screw rods 19, the two moving frames 20 are driven to move in opposite directions simultaneously, when the protection plate 22 is moved to the front side and the rear side of the cargo from the bottom of the pallet fork 2, the third motor 21 is started to drive the protection plate 22 to rotate, the protection plate 22 is enabled to be flush with the side of the cargo, the side of the cargo is protected, the chain wheel 5 is driven to rotate by operation of the first motor 6 according to the height of the cargo, the chain 7 is driven to move, and the movable connection between the moving, thereby driving the moving plate 10 to move along the track of the moving port 4, thereby adjusting the height of the pedal 11 from the ground, and stopping the operation of the first motor 6 when the eyes of the worker are higher than the height of the goods.
